India star batter Virat Kohli is set to train with Delhi’s team on Tuesday, January 28 ahead of what will be his first appearance in the domestic tournament since 2012. Delhi coach Sarandeep Singh confirmed the 36-year-old’s availability for their final group stage fixture which is set to be played against Railways from January 30 at the Arun Jaitley stadium.
This comes after BCCI had recently issued guidelines to contracted players, stating that they will have to feature in domestic cricket when not on national duty. These guidelines came following the Men in Blue’s comprehensive 3-1 defeat against Australia in Border-Gavaskar series.
Kohli had opted out of Delhi’s previous Ranji Trophy clash against Saurashtra due to a neck injury. However, the out-of-form batter is all set to make his return to domestic cricket in Delhi’s upcoming encounter.
Over the last couple of days, photos and videos have emerged on social media of Kohli working with former India and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B) batting coach Sanjay Bangar at a training facility in Mumbai.
The final round of the Ranji Trophy will conclude by February 2, just in time for India’s 3-match ODI series against England which is set to commence from February 6. Kohli is a part of the Men in Blue’s squad which will take on The Three Lions ahead of the ICC Champions Trophy that will commence from February 19.
